>> The use case in which a conference is password-protected
>> (muc#roomconfig_passwordprotected=1) and muc#roomconfig_roomsecret is
>> not configured or left blank, is not well described in the spec.
>>
>> Is setting this configuration considered legal?

> Those two seem a little redundant. I would interpret a blank password as
> the room not being password protected. So out of you list I personally
> would pick:
>
>> - let everyone in regardless of password?
>
>
> This one. :-)
>
> Does anyone disagree with me? If not then perhaps the check box option
> needs to be dropped?
I disagree. I would let the room with an empty password, since it's what
has been configured and it's possible to respect it.
